Greetings from a snowy Naeba.
Today's report brings thrilling news – we've measured a whopping 44cm of fresh snow, and it's still coming down! However, due to strong winds, Gondola 2 and Dragondola are temporarily closed for safety.
Traveling from the town area of Yuzawa to Naeba might take a bit longer today, with substantial snow clearing on the roads causing a doubling of travel time. And make sure to wear those extra layers as it's windy out there.
The weather forecast is promising, with tomorrow expected to be sunny, offering the perfect backdrop to enjoy the newly fallen snow. Fingers crossed for ideal conditions! 🤞
Stay warm and stay safe.
